Fiber cut-off wavelength
Publish:Box Optronics  Time:2022-04-24  Views:1370
The normal transmission mode of single-mode fiber is linear polarization mode, (including two orthogonal modes). The so-called cut-off wavelength refers to the cut-off wavelength of higher-order modes (including four degenerate modes composed of two circular polarization modes and two orthogonal modes). The operating wavelength of the single-mode optical fiber transmission system must be greater than the cut-off wavelength, otherwise, the optical fiber will work in the dual-mode area. Due to the existence of modes, mode noise and multi-mode dispersion will be generated, which will lead to the deterioration of transmission performance and the reduction of bandwidth.
